Adelaide PEER Exam Week Starting 17th Jan 2012
 
Well after over 3 years of planning and hard work we will finally be arriving in Adelaide on the 09th Jan 2012.

I have been doing the wiring regs course via distance learning and just got myself booked on the exam week (3-4 days) starting on the 17th Jan.

Is there anyone esle booked in for this exam week course ?

And as anyone done the PEER wiring regs course and course and give me an insight as toi what to expect. Is it a bit like the 17TH edition course or more indepth.

Just had a look back at what i posted after i passed. My post is quoted below. BTW its an open book test.



For those doing or about to do the PEER route. Make sure you do the book. Though not all questions in the test are covered with what you have already filled in. Actually not many. Make sure you do maximum demand and make sure you get the guy to run through it with you. Make sure you take notes, make sure you take colouring pencils, ruler and sharpener with you. Swot up on impedance. Make sure you ask questions. The teacher we had Jess was very helpful. He was hardly in the class though . I started with the maximum demand and calculations plus drawing as it was fresh in my head. The other 2 guys started with the clause. I finished hours before them. So its up to you. But I'd say do what i done. Good luck
